写点什么

淘宝天猫 API 接口深度解析:商品详情与关键词搜索商品列表的使用方法及代码示例

作者:代码忍者
  • 2024-12-19
    江西
  • 本文字数:1263 字

    阅读完需:约 4 分钟

在当今电子商务蓬勃发展的时代,淘宝和天猫作为国内领先的电商平台,其 API 接口为开发者提供了丰富的功能,帮助商家和企业实现更加高效、个性化的商品信息获取和展示。本文将详细介绍如何使用淘宝天猫 API 接口进行商品详情查询和关键词搜索商品列表,并提供相应的代码示例,助力开发者更好地利用这些接口。

一、注册与申请 API 权限

首先,使用淘宝天猫API接口的第一步是在淘宝天猫开放平台注册成为开发者。具体步骤如下:

  1. 注册开发者账号:在淘宝天猫开放平台官网完成注册,并完成相关认证。

  2. 创建新应用:登录开放平台后,创建一个新的应用,并填写应用的基本信息,包括应用名称、应用类型、应用描述等。

  3. 提交审核:填写完应用信息后,提交审核。审核通过后,你将获得 AppKey 和 AppSecret,这两个密钥是调用 API 接口的必要凭证。

二、商品详情 API 接口使用方法

获取商品详情是电商开发中常见的需求,通过淘宝天猫的商品详情 API 接口,可以轻松获取商品的详细信息,如价格、标题、图片、描述等。以下是使用商品详情 API 接口的步骤:

  1. 构建 HTTP 请求:根据 API 文档,构建 HTTP 请求,通常包括请求 URL、请求方法(GET 或 POST)、必要的请求头和查询参数。在查询参数中,需要提供商品的 ID,以便 API 能够返回对应的商品详情。

  2. 发送请求并处理响应:使用 HTTP 客户端库(如 Python 的 requests 库)发送请求,并处理返回的 JSON 数据。返回的数据通常包含商品的详细信息。

以下是使用 Python 进行商品详情查询的示例代码:

python复制代码
复制代码

三、关键词搜索商品列表 API 接口使用方法

关键词搜索商品列表是电商网站和应用中不可或缺的功能。通过淘宝天猫的关键词搜索商品列表 API 接口,可以获取与关键词相关的商品列表,并根据需求进行筛选和排序。以下是使用关键词搜索商品列表 API 接口的步骤:

  1. 构建 HTTP 请求:根据 API 文档,构建 HTTP 请求,包括请求 URL、请求方法(通常为 GET)、必要的请求头和查询参数。查询参数可能包括搜索关键词、排序方式、页码、每页商品数量等。

  2. 发送请求并处理响应:使用 HTTP 客户端库发送请求,并处理返回的 JSON 数据。返回的数据通常包含商品的详细信息列表,如商品 ID、标题、价格、图片等。

以下是使用 Python 进行关键词搜索商品列表的示例代码:

python复制代码
复制代码

四、注意事项与规范

在使用淘宝天猫 API 接口时,开发者需要遵循以下注意事项与规范:

  1. 保护密钥:API 密钥是访问 API 接口的凭证,应妥善保管,避免泄露给他人。

  2. 合理使用:开发者应合理使用 API 接口,避免频繁调用或超出限额,以免对平台造成不必要的负担。

  3. 数据安全:在处理返回的商品详情信息时,应注意数据的安全性,避免泄露用户隐私和商业机密。

  4. 遵循规范:使用 API 接口时,应遵循淘宝天猫开放平台的规范和要求,包括请求格式、参数传递、返回结果处理等方面。

五、结语

通过本文的介绍,相信读者已经对如何使用淘宝天猫 API 接口实现商品详情查询和关键词搜索商品列表有了更深入的了解。这些 API 接口为电商业务提供了强大的数据支持,助力开发者实现更加个性化、高效的商品信息服务。随着电商平台的不断发展和完善,API 接口将成为商家与平台之间的重要桥梁,帮助商家实现更高效、更智能的运营管理。

用户头像

代码忍者

关注

还未添加个人签名 2024-07-23 加入

还未添加个人简介

评论

发布
暂无评论
淘宝天猫API接口深度解析:商品详情与关键词搜索商品列表的使用方法及代码示例_淘宝API接口、_代码忍者_InfoQ写作社区